Dexil Ltd / Friendly Dog Collars(TM) have created Award Winning (K9 Breeders and Associates pet product of the year) color coded dog collars, leashes, harnesses, and coats to assist with socialising and prevent unwanted attention and possible dog accidents when in public areas.These worded, embroidered, brightly colored dog awareness products are designed with safety in mind to aid yourself, other dog walkers, adults and children from a distance with what type of nature/temperament of the dog that is approaching them. We are confident that this color coded system could assist with preventing the number of dog bites/attacks and reduce unprompted fights between dogs whilst out in public or on a walk. Now currently being stocked in over 600 stores worldwide in 25 countries, this is the best way to allow others to know your dog in advance.The system: Red 'CAUTION' (Do Not Approach) Orange 'NO DOGS' (Not good with other dogs), Green 'FRIENDLY': (Known as friendly to all), Yellow 'NERVOUS', Blue 'TRAINING', Blue 'SERVICE DOG', White 'BLIND DOG', White 'DEAF DOG', Purple 'DO NOT FEED', Yellow 'ADOPT ME'Also with the other ranges we do, the public can be pre-warned about a certain other dogs' needs in advance. By being pre-warned about a certain dogs temperament so many situations can be avoided cutting down on the 8 million dog bites reported on adults and children worldwide each year.
